Phelps, L. Allen; Jin, Misug – 1997
Employer attitudes toward Wisconsin's Youth Apprenticeship Program were examined through a survey that was sent to 260 of the 733 employers involved in the Youth Apprenticeship Program in 1996-1997. Of those employers, 149 (57.3%) returned usable replies. Overall, the employers were very pleased with the Youth Apprenticeship Program's design and…

Four adult education programs serving homeless persons in Wisconsin were evaluated. Data were gathered through site visits, a review of program documents, and a survey of 43 homeless individuals served by the programs (7 percent of the total population served). Participants expressed very positive feelings about the programs. Many reported that…
